Main subject categories: • Stationary partial differential equations • Differential equations • Partial differential equations • Semilinear Elliptic Systems: Existence, Multiplicity, Symmetry of Solutions • Nonlinear Variational Problems via the Fibering Method • Superlinear Elliptic Equations and Systems • Nonlinear Eigenvalue Problem with Quantization • Stationary Problem of Boltzmann Equation • Existence and Stability of Spikes for the Gierer–Meinhardt System

This handbook is the fifth volume in the series devoted to stationary partial differential equations. As the preceding volumes, it is a collection of self-contained, state-of-the-art surveys written by well-known experts in the field.

The topics covered by this volume include in particular semilinear and superlinear elliptic systems, the fibering method for nonlinear variational problems, some nonlinear eigenvalue problems, the studies of the stationary Boltzmann equation and the Gierer–Meinhardt system. I hope that these surveys will be useful for both beginners and experts and help to the diffusion of these recent deep results in mathematical science.
